CFGI is seeking a Consultant to support private equity value creation initiatives, operational improvement programs, and strategic internal initiatives.
This role will focus on initiative governance, program management, analytics, executive reporting, and general management support. The Consultant will work closely with CFGI leadership to drive execution, track progress, surface risks, develop insights, and support delivery of measurable business outcomes.
Key Responsibilities:- Support development of value creation playbooks and operational improvement frameworks.
- Coordinate initiative tracking, milestone management, and performance reporting.
- Establish and maintain governance tools, workplans, risk logs, and status updates.
- Support executive operating reviews, steering committee meetings, and leadership updates.
- Conduct operational, market, and business performance analyses.
- Build executive dashboards, scorecards, and board-ready presentations.
- Track KPIs, risks, dependencies, and implementation progress across initiatives.
- Facilitate cross-functional coordination across initiative owners and business leaders.
- Synthesize complex analyses into clear insights and recommendations.
- Support strategic initiatives and special projects across the organization.
- Bachelor’s degree in Business, Economics, Engineering, Mathematics, Finance, Analytics, or related field.
- Two to five years of experience in consulting, corporate strategy, business analytics, operations, program management, or operational improvement at a MBB firm (McKinsey, Bain, BCG) or Big4 is preferred.
- Strong analytical and structured problem-solving capabilities.
- Advanced Excel and PowerPoint skills.
- Strong project management and organizational skills.
- Ability to manage multiple workstreams and deadlines simultaneously.
- Excellent communication and executive presentation skills.
- Experience at a consulting firm, corporate strategy team, operations team, or private equity-backed company.
- Experience supporting value creation, operational improvement, or performance management initiatives.
- Experience building executive dashboards, KPI reporting, and leadership materials.
- Exposure to private equity clients or portfolio companies.
- Experience with Power BI, Tableau, Alteryx, Smartsheet, Monday.com, or similar tools.
- Experience supporting governance processes, executive meetings, or cross-functional programs.

What you need to know about the San Francisco Tech Scene
San Francisco and the surrounding Bay Area attracts more startup funding than any other region in the world. Home to Stanford University and UC Berkeley, leading VC firms and several of the world’s most valuable companies, the Bay Area is the place to go for anyone looking to make it big in the tech industry. That said, San Francisco has a lot to offer beyond technology thanks to a thriving art and music scene, excellent food and a short drive to several of the country’s most beautiful recreational areas.
Key Facts About San Francisco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 365,500; 13.9%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Google, Apple, Salesforce, Meta
-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, fintech, consumer technology, software
- Funding Landscape: $50.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Sequoia Capital, Andreessen Horowitz, Bessemer Venture Partners, Greylock Partners, Khosla Ventures, Kleiner Perkins
- Research Centers and Universities: Stanford University; University of California, Berkeley; University of San Francisco; Santa Clara University; Ames Research Center; Center for AI Safety; California Institute for Regenerative Medicine
